The Chartered Institute of Housing (CIH) has awarded honorary membership to Michael Gelling OBE - Chair of the Tenants and Residents Organisations of England, Anthony Mayer - Chairman of the Tenant Services Authority and David Orr - Chief Executive of the National Housing Federation.
CIH President Howard Farrand presented the awards at the CIH Presidential Dinner at the Natural History Museum in London. He said: "I am absolutely delighted that CIH is awarding Honorary CIH Membership to three very distinguished members of the housing community. Michael Gelling, Anthony Mayer and David Orr have all made significant and valued contributions to the housing sector and have championed the interests of tenants. They have also been great friends and supporters of CIH.
"CIH represents people involved in housing across the whole of the UK and within all spheres of the housing sector and we take pride in being able to recognise individuals who have made a significant contribution to our sector through the award of Honorary CIH Membership."
